two.1.4) Short description

On behalf of Gold Hill HA, B2G.services are tendering a national DPS for use by any UK contracting authority wishing to procure construction, repair, maintenance or improvement works, supplies and services, and all associated works supplies and services, in relation to any asset class of property, anywhere in the UK.

Suppliers may specify their preferences in terms of region, project value and work type including but not limited to roofing, insulation, windows, doors, kitchens, bathrooms, heating, electrics, painting, decorating, adaptations, scaffolding, groundworks, landscaping, demolition, security, cleaning, waste collection and disposal.

To optimise efficiency and compliance in both procurement and delivery of a project, this DPS is designed to be used in tandem with B2G frameworks where a significant part of the project may be sub-contracted, and in which case the B2G framework supplier may assign it in whole or part to their approved / specialist contractor registered on the DPS, who then contracts with the authority under the DPS and delivers the works, supplies and or services under the auspices of the B2G framework supplier, who continues to oversee delivery of the project.
